CDL Training Costs in Florida

CDL training in Florida typically ranges from $3,000 to $8,000 for private schools, with community colleges offering programs from $2,000 to $5,000. Many trucking companies also offer paid CDL training programs with a 1-2 year employment commitment.

Frequently Asked Questions About CDL Training in Winter Haven

How long does CDL training take in Winter Haven?
CDL training programs in Winter Haven, FL typically take 3-8 weeks for full-time students. Part-time programs may take 3-6 months. Company-sponsored programs often run 4-6 weeks with guaranteed job placement upon completion.
How much does CDL school cost in Florida?
CDL training costs in Florida range from $3,000-$10,000 for private schools, $1,500-$5,000 at community colleges, and FREE through company-sponsored programs (with employment commitment). Many schools accept WIOA grants, GI Bill benefits, and offer payment plans.
Can I get a CDL in Winter Haven without quitting my job?
Yes, several CDL schools in the Winter Haven area offer weekend and evening classes for working adults. These flexible schedules allow you to earn your CDL while keeping your current job. Weekend programs typically take 8-16 weeks to complete.
How do I know if a CDL school in Winter Haven is legitimate?
All legitimate CDL schools must be registered in the FMCSA Training Provider Registry (TPR) at tpr.fmcsa.dot.gov. You can verify any school there. Be wary of schools that promise a CDL in less than 2 weeks or cannot provide their TPR registration number. The FMCSA removed over 550 non-compliant providers in 2025-2026 alone.
Do I need ELDT training to get a CDL?
Yes, as of February 2022, all first-time CDL applicants must complete Entry-Level Driver Training (ELDT) from an FMCSA-registered training provider before taking the CDL skills test. All schools listed on CDL Schools USA are ELDT-compliant. The ELDT requirement includes both theory instruction (30+ hours) and behind-the-wheel training.
Can I get financial aid for CDL school in Florida?
Yes, several funding options exist for CDL training in Florida: WIOA (Workforce Innovation and Opportunity Act) grants, Pell Grants at eligible community colleges, VA benefits for veterans, and company-sponsored training programs. Contact individual schools to learn about their specific financial aid options.
Why is Florida good for new CDL drivers?
Florida offers several unique advantages for CDL drivers: no state income tax (higher take-home pay), year-round work with no seasonal slowdowns, three major ports (PortMiami, Port Everglades, JAXPORT) creating container hauling demand, constant construction creating flatbed/dump truck jobs, and tourism logistics requiring dedicated freight service. CDL drivers in Florida average $54,600/year, with port drivers earning up to $78,000.
What types of trucking jobs are available near Winter Haven?
The Winter Haven, FL area offers diverse trucking jobs: regional LTL freight along I-95/I-75, port drayage from Florida's major ports, construction hauling (Florida's building boom shows no signs of slowing), refrigerated transport for Florida's agriculture and food service industry, and tourism logistics supporting theme parks, resorts, and cruise lines. Many positions offer home-daily or home-weekly schedules.
